VCSH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

831 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ard Short-Term Corporate Bond ETF (VCSH)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$14.4B — up 1.6% from $14.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 165 funds opened new VCSH positions and 42 closed out — a net gain of 123 holders — while 350 added to existing stakes and 225 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al Bank of Canada, adding an estimated $58.4M. The largest seller was Ilmarinen Mutual Pension Insurance, exiting entirely with an estimated $102M sold.
